JIVITPUTRIKA FESTIVAL

 

  1. Jitiya (also called Jivitputrika) is a 3 day long Hindu festival celebrated from the 7th to 9th lunar day of Krishna-Paksha in Ashvin month. 
  2. The festival is celebrated in the states of Uttar Pradesh, Bihar and Jharkhand as well as Nepali people of West Bengal.
  3. The three-day long festival includes:
    1. First day is Nahai-Khai
    2. Khur-Jitiya or Jiviputrika day – mothers follow strict fasting for their children
    3. Third day Parana- mothers break fasting.
